Former City Club President Jay Doherty was sentenced to one year in prison for his role in a scheme to illegally influence then-Illinois House Speaker Michael Madigan on behalf of ComEd.
U.S. District Judge Manish Shah delivered the sentence in a Chicago courtroom on Tuesday. He said Doherty was key to maintaining a “secret relationship” between the utility and the former house speaker.
“You and your company were the metaphoric cash in an envelope that amounted to bribes,” Shah said from the bench.
Shah’s sentence came after Doherty addressed the judge and took responsibility for his crimes.
